android 開發-HttpClient狀態代碼定義

來源:互聯網
上載者:User

標籤:

TP 定義的狀態碼的值(.net HttpWebResponse.HttpStatusCode

成員名稱 說明
Continue 等效於 HTTP 狀態 100。Continue 指示用戶端可能繼續其請求。
SwitchingProtocols 等效於 HTTP 狀態 101。SwitchingProtocols 指示正在更改協議版本或協議。
OK 等效於 HTTP 狀態 200。OK 指示請求成功,且請求的資訊包含在響應中。這是最常接收的狀態碼。
Created 等效於 HTTP 狀態 201。Created 指示請求導致在響應被發送前建立新資源。
Accepted 等效於 HTTP 狀態 202。Accepted 指示請求已被接受做進一步處理。
NonAuthoritativeInformation 等效於 HTTP 狀態 203。NonAuthoritativeInformation 指示返回的元資訊來自快取複本而不是原始伺服器,因此可能不正確。
NoContent 等效於 HTTP 狀態 204。NoContent 指示已成功處理請求並且響應已被設定為無內容。
ResetContent 等效於 HTTP 狀態 205。ResetContent 指示用戶端應重設(或重新載入)當前資源。
PartialContent 等效於 HTTP 狀態 206。PartialContent 指示響應是包括位元組範圍的 GET 請求所請求的部分響應。
MultipleChoices 等效於 HTTP 狀態 300。MultipleChoices 指示請求的資訊有多種表示形式。預設操作是將此狀態視為重新導向,並遵循與此響應關聯的 Location 頭的內容。
Ambiguous 等效於 HTTP 狀態 300。Ambiguous 指示請求的資訊有多種表示形式。預設操作是將此狀態視為重新導向,並遵循與此響應關聯的 Location 頭的內容。
MovedPermanently 等效於 HTTP 狀態 301。MovedPermanently 指示請求的資訊已移到 Location 頭中指定的 URI 處。接收到此狀態時的預設操作為遵循與響應關聯的 Location 頭。
Moved 等效於 HTTP 狀態 301。Moved 指示請求的資訊已移到 Location 頭中指定的 URI 處。接收到此狀態時的預設操作為遵循與響應關聯的 Location 頭。原始要求方法為 POST 時,重新導向的請求將使用 GET 方法。
Found 等效於 HTTP 狀態 302。Found 指示請求的資訊位於 Location 頭中指定的 URI 處。接收到此狀態時的預設操作為遵循與響應關聯的 Location 頭。原始要求方法為 POST 時,重新導向的請求將使用 GET 方法。
Redirect 等效於 HTTP 狀態 302。Redirect 指示請求的資訊位於 Location 頭中指定的 URI 處。接收到此狀態時的預設操作為遵循與響應關聯的 Location 頭。原始要求方法為 POST 時,重新導向的請求將使用 GET 方法。
SeeOther 等效於 HTTP 狀態 303。作為 POST 的結果,SeeOther 將用戶端自動重新導向到 Location 頭中指定的 URI。用 GET 產生對 Location 頭所指定的資源的請求。
RedirectMethod 等效於 HTTP 狀態 303。作為 POST 的結果,RedirectMethod 將用戶端自動重新導向到 Location 頭中指定的 URI。用 GET 產生對 Location 頭所指定的資源的請求。
NotModified 等效於 HTTP 狀態 304。NotModified 指示用戶端的快取複本是最新的。未傳輸此資源的內容。
UseProxy 等效於 HTTP 狀態 305。UseProxy 指示請求應使用位於 Location 頭中指定的 URI 的Proxy 伺服器。
Unused 等效於 HTTP 狀態 306。Unused 是未完全指定的 HTTP/1.1 規範的建議擴充。
TemporaryRedirect 等效於 HTTP 狀態 307。TemporaryRedirect 指示請求資訊位於 Location 頭中指定的 URI 處。接收到此狀態時的預設操作為遵循與響應關聯的 Location 頭。原始要求方法為 POST 時,重新導向的請求還將使用 POST 方法。
RedirectKeepVerb 等效於 HTTP 狀態 307。RedirectKeepVerb 指示請求資訊位於 Location 頭中指定的 URI 處。接收到此狀態時的預設操作為遵循與響應關聯的 Location 頭。原始要求方法為 POST 時,重新導向的請求還將使用 POST 方法。
BadRequest 等效於 HTTP 狀態 400。BadRequest 指示伺服器未能識別請求。如果沒有其他適用的錯誤,或者如果不知道準確的錯誤或錯誤沒有自己的錯誤碼,則發送 BadRequest。
Unauthorized 等效於 HTTP 狀態 401。Unauthorized 指示請求的資源要求身分識別驗證。WWW-Authenticate 頭包含如何執行身分識別驗證的詳細資料。
PaymentRequired 等效於 HTTP 狀態 402。保留 PaymentRequired 以供將來使用。
Forbidden 等效於 HTTP 狀態 403。Forbidden 指示伺服器拒絕滿足請求。
NotFound 等效於 HTTP 狀態 404。NotFound 指示請求的資源不在伺服器上。
MethodNotAllowed 等效於 HTTP 狀態 405。MethodNotAllowed 指示請求的資源上不允許要求方法(POST 或 GET)。
NotAcceptable 等效於 HTTP 狀態 406。NotAcceptable 指示用戶端已用 Accept 頭指示將不接受資源的任何可用表示形式。
ProxyAuthenticationRequired 等效於 HTTP 狀態 407。ProxyAuthenticationRequired 指示請求的代理要求身分識別驗證。Proxy-authenticate 頭包含如何執行身分識別驗證的詳細資料。
RequestTimeout 等效於 HTTP 狀態 408。RequestTimeout 指示用戶端沒有在伺服器期望請求的時間內發送請求。
Conflict 等效於 HTTP 狀態 409。Conflict 指示由於伺服器上的衝突而未能執行請求。
Gone 等效於 HTTP 狀態 410。Gone 指示請求的資源不再可用。
LengthRequired 等效於 HTTP 狀態 411。LengthRequired 指示缺少必需的 Content-length 頭。
PreconditionFailed 等效於 HTTP 狀態 412。PreconditionFailed 指示為此請求設定的條件失敗,且無法執行此請求。條件是用條件請求標題(如 If-Match、If-None-Match 或 If-Unmodified-Since)設定的。
RequestEntityTooLarge 等效於 HTTP 狀態 413。RequestEntityTooLarge 指示請求太大,伺服器無法處理。
RequestUriTooLong 等效於 HTTP 狀態 414。RequestUriTooLong 指示 URI 太長。
UnsupportedMediaType 等效於 HTTP 狀態 415。UnsupportedMediaType 指示請求是不支援的類型。
RequestedRangeNotSatisfiable 等效於 HTTP 狀態 416。RequestedRangeNotSatisfiable 指示無法返回從資源請求的資料範圍,因為範圍的開頭在資源的開頭之前,或因為範圍的結尾在資源的結尾之後。
ExpectationFailed 等效於 HTTP 狀態 417。ExpectationFailed 指示伺服器未能符合 Expect 頭中給定的預期值。
InternalServerError 等效於 HTTP 狀態 500。InternalServerError 指示伺服器上發生了一般錯誤。
NotImplemented 等效於 HTTP 狀態 501。NotImplemented 指示伺服器不支援要求的函數。
BadGateway 等效於 HTTP 狀態 502。BadGateway 指示中間Proxy 伺服器從另一代理或原始伺服器接收到錯誤響應。
ServiceUnavailable 等效於 HTTP 狀態 503。ServiceUnavailable 指示伺服器暫時不可用,通常是由於過多載入或維護。
GatewayTimeout 等效於 HTTP 狀態 504。GatewayTimeout 指示中間Proxy 伺服器在等待來自另一個代理或原始伺服器的響應時已逾時。
HttpVersionNotSupported 等效於 HTTP 狀態 505。HttpVersionNotSupported 指示伺服器不支援要求的 HTTP 版本。

android 開發-HttpClient狀態代碼定義

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.